So, if you are wondering\u00a0 how to stop F1 from opening Help, you\u2019ve come to the right place.<\/p>\n<p>Here\u2019s how to disable the F1 Help key in Windows 10.<\/p>\n<h2>How to Disable the Windows F1 Help Key<\/h2>\n<p>Here are a few options for how to turn off the Windows <i>F1 Help <\/i>key:<\/p>\n<h3>Method 1: Disable the Windows F1 help key using the Windows Registry<\/h3>\n<p>Before we show you the process of disabling the function key, remember that <a href=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/registry-cleaner\/\">the registry<\/a> is a database that contains the essential settings required for your OS to function.<\/p>\n<p>You should note that editing the Windows Registry is a risky process.<\/p>\n<p>It could be compared to performing brain surgery, but on your machine. The slightest error can cause your system to crash. And you\u2019d have to <a href=\"https:\/\/www.windowscentral.com\/how-do-clean-installation-windows-10\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ener nofollow\">perform a fresh installation<\/a>.<\/p>\n<p>We therefore suggest that you create a system restore point before making any changes in the Windows Registry.<\/p>\n<p><b>How to create a system restore point in Windows 10<\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click the Windows button to open the Start menu.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Type <em>Create a restore point<\/em>\u00a0in the search bar and click the matching result to open the <em>System Properties<\/em> experience.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click the <em>Create<\/em> button under the <em>Protection settings<\/em>\u00a0category.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Type a descriptive name that will help you remember why you created the restore point. For example, you can use something like <em>Restore Point Before&#8230;<\/em><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2023\/10\/create-a-system-restore-point.webp\" alt=\"create a system restore point\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click the <em>Create<\/em> button.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click <em>Close<\/em> and click <em>OK<\/em>.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"shcode-askquestion\">\r\n\t<div class=\"shcode-askquestion__heading\">Need help with your PC?<\/div>\r\n\t<div class=\"shcode-askquestion__text\">Try our <a href=\"https:\/\/qa.auslogics.com\/questions\/most_commented\" target=\"_blank\">Ask a Question<\/a> service &mdash; our experts will diagnose and resolve your PC issues completely free of charge.<\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<p>After creating a system restore point, you can now go ahead and make changes that will disable the F1 key on your computer. Follow these steps:<\/p>\n<p><strong>How to disable F1 help key using Windows Registry<\/strong><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Open the registry. To do this, hold the <code>Windows key + R<\/code> to invoke the Run accessory. Then type <em>Regedit<\/em>\u00a0and hit <em>Enter<\/em>.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2023\/10\/Run-regedit-on-Windows-PC.png\" alt=\"Run regedit on Windows PC\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">A User Account Control (UAC) prompt will be presented to you. Click the <em>Yes<\/em> button on the dialog to indicate that you want the Registry Editor to make changes to your computer.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">When the Registry Editor window opens, we recommend that you create a backup first. So follow these steps:<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click <em>Computer<\/em> in the left panel and then click the <em>File<\/em> tab in the menu bar.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Select <em>Export<\/em>.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Enter a name for the backup file. For example, you can type something like <em>Registry Backup for F1 key deactivation<\/em>.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2023\/10\/registrybackup-1.webp\" alt=\"registry backup\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Choose a safe location to save the file on your computer.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click the <em>Save<\/em> button.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>If something goes wrong during the registry modification, you can easily run the .reg backup file and regain the normal working condition of your computer.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">After you\u2019ve created a backup, double-click, navigate the path: <em>SYSTEM &gt; CurrentControlSet &gt; Control &gt; Keyboard Layout<\/em><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2023\/10\/Registry-Ediotor-Keyboard-Layout-1.webp\" alt=\"Registry Editor Keyboard Layout\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Then navigate the path: <em>SYSTEM &gt; CurrentControlSet &gt; Control &gt; Keyboard Layout<\/em><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><strong>Tip:<\/strong> To get to the final destination (that is Keyboard Layout) faster, copy the following address and paste it into the Registry Editor\u2019s address bar:<\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\"><i>H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\\SYSTEM\\CurrentControlSet\\Control\\Keyboard Layout<\/i><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Double-click on Scancode Map and enter the following value into the Value data box:<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\"><em>00000000 00000000 02000000 00003B00 00000000<\/em><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click <em>OK<\/em> to save the setting.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Close the Registry Editor.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>After you\u2019ve performed the above procedure, the F1 key will no longer be functional. If you\u2019d like to undo the change, go back to the Keyboard Layout key and change the value data for Scancode Map to 00000000 00000000 00000000 00000000 00000000.<\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<p><strong>\ud83d\udccc Also read: <\/strong><a href=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/fixing-restore-point-not-working-in-windows-10\/\">[FIXED] System Restore Not Working in Windows 10<\/a><\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<h3>Method 2: Disabling the Windows F1 key using AutoHotkey<\/h3>\n<p>AutoHotkey is a free tool that you can use to create scripts for executing both simple and complex tasks on Windows. You can build auto-clickers, form builders, macros, and more with AutoHotkey. This tool makes it possible to remap keys and create hotkeys. So we can use it to easily disable the F1 key on your computer: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Visit <a href=\"https:\/\/www.autohotkey.com\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ener nofollow\">autohotkey.com<\/a> to download the AutoHotkey app installation file.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Run the file and follow the instructions presented by the installation wizard to complete the process.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Afterward, minimize the app and right-click on your desktop. Select <em>New<\/em> from the context menu and click on AutoHotkey script.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">You can rename the new script if you like. But make sure that you don\u2019t remove the .ahk extension.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Right-click on the newly created script and select <em>Edit Script<\/em> from the context menu.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">At the end of the text that\u2019s already in the script, hit <em>Enter<\/em> to skip a line and then copy and paste (or type) <em>F1::return <\/em>(don\u2019t include the quotation marks).<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">To save the change, press <code>Ctrl + S<\/code> or click the <em>File<\/em> tab in the menu bar and click <em>Save<\/em>.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Close the script window.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Running the script is all that\u2019s left now. So right-click on it and select <em>Run Script<\/em>\u00a0from the context menu. It will disable the F1 key on your computer\u2019s keyboard.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">If you click the <em>Show hidden icons<\/em> button on your taskbar, and right-click on the AutoHotkey icon, you will find the options for pausing, reloading, suspending, editing, or stopping the script.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<hr \/>\n<p><b>\ud83d\udccc Also read: <\/b><a href=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/fixing-windows-10-keyboard-types-the-wrong-characters\/\">[FIXED] Why is My Keyboard Typing the Wrong Letters?<\/a><\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<h3>Method 3: Re-Mapping the Windows F1 Key Using SharpKeys<\/h3>\n<p>SharpKeys is a free tool that is used for remapping Windows keys. Unlike AutoHotkey, you won\u2019t have to do any scripting. The keys are already available on the interface, making SharpKeys very easy to use. Here is how to use it to disable the F1 key on your keyboard: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Download SharpKeys from GitHub and run it.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click on the Add button on the <a href=\"https:\/\/github.com\/randyrants\/sharpkeys\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ener nofollow\">https:\/\/github.com\/randyrants\/sharpkeys<\/a> Home interface.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Locate \u2018Function: F1 (00_3B) in the Map this key list.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><b>Tip: <\/b>To make things easier, simply click on the <em>Type Key<\/em> button under the Map this key category on the left. When prompted to press a button on your keyboard, press F1 to allow SharpKeys to detect the button. It will display a message that says, <em>You Pressed: Function: F1 (00_3B).<\/em>\u00a0Then click <em>OK<\/em> to close the <em>Type Key<\/em> box.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click on Turn Key Off (00_00)from the \u2018To this key\u2019 list on the right-hand side. The item is the first in the list.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click the <em>OK<\/em> button.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Now, click the <em>Write to Registry<\/em> button.<\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Restart your computer.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>After your computer reboots, pressing the F1 key will no longer invoke the Help page of an app you are on. If you\u2019d like to re-enable the F1, launch SharpKeys and delete the entry you previously created. Then click the \u2018Write to registry\u2019 button.<\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<p><b>\ud83d\udccc Also read: <\/b><a href=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/winkey-not-working-on-windows-10\/\">[FIXED] How to Fix Windows Key Not Working on Windows 10 and 11?<\/a><\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<h2>Conclusion<\/h2>\n<p>This post reveals how to disable the F1 Help key.
